.. _file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_compute_high_level_function.hpp: File function.hpp ================= |exhale_lsh| :ref:`Parent directory ` (``/home/runner/work/Legion-Engine/Legion-Engine/legion/engine/core/compute/high_level``) .. |exhale_lsh| unicode:: U+021B0 .. UPWARDS ARROW WITH TIP LEFTWARDS .. contents:: Contents :local: :backlinks: none Definition (``/home/runner/work/Legion-Engine/Legion-Engine/legion/engine/core/compute/high_level/function.hpp``) ----------------------------------------------------------------------------------------------------------------- .. toctree:: :maxdepth: 1 program_listing_file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_compute_high_level_function.hpp.rst Includes -------- - ``Optick/optick.h`` - ``array`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_rendering_data_vertexarray.cpp`) - ``core/common/result.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_common_result.hpp`) - ``core/compute/buffer.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_compute_buffer.hpp`) - ``core/compute/kernel.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_compute_kernel.hpp`) - ``core/compute/program.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_compute_program.hpp`) - ``core/detail/internals.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_detail_internals.hpp`) - ``core/filesystem/resource.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_filesystem_resource.hpp`) - ``core/types/meta.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_types_meta.hpp`) - ``core/types/primitives.hpp`` (: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_types_primitives.hpp`) - ``tuple`` - ``type_traits`` - ``variant`` Included By ----------- - :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_core_compute_high_level_function.cpp` - :ref:`file__home_runner_work_Legion-Engine_Legion-Engine_legion_engine_rendering_systems_pointcloudgeneration.hpp` Namespaces ---------- - :ref:`namespace_legion` - :ref:`namespace_legion__core` - :ref:`namespace_legion__core__compute` - :ref:`namespace_legion__core__compute__detail` Classes ------- -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1detail_1_1buffer__base` -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1in__ident` -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1inout` -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1inout__ident` -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1invalid__karg__type` -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1karg` - :ref:`exhale_struct_structlegion_1_1core_1_1compute_1_1out__ident` - :ref:`exhale_class_classlegion_1_1core_1_1compute_1_1function` - :ref:`exhale_class_classlegion_1_1core_1_1compute_1_1function__base` - :ref:`exhale_class_structlegion_1_1core_1_1compute_1_1in` - :ref:`exhale_class_structlegion_1_1core_1_1compute_1_1out`